Transaction 88c23c8c66a00c06ee99a53b80dfc74644bceab2ecc3154ba73108740e4ce8db
1 Input
1 Output
-
88c23c8c66a00c06ee99a53b80dfc74644bceab2ecc3154ba73108740e4ce8db:0
- value
- 498388800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cae13a58c2d933f1a2cf6374d5d5fa08b782cf91 OP_EQUAL
- address
- 3LBkEQMfYMXviorfb1EjJJVV3M1Qn1yi7w